Suppose we are searching for some key r in a BST. As we perform the search, we compare z to the keys on the path from the root to the leaf in the BST. Which sequence below cannot be the sequence of keys examined during the search? Explain why not. Do not assume that the search below is performed on the same BST 85, 76, 30, 15, 6, 1 13, 98, 28, 94, 33, 85, 48, 77, 51, 62, 55 99, 78, 44, 87, 57, 52 16, 33, 77, 54, 73, 60 67, 24, 74, 55, 48 Solution (e) is the option. In BST ,First we search for the root. If the key is greater than root then we recur in the right sub tree or we recur in the left sub tree. In (e) the root is 67. The key is not 67 that\'s why we recurred to left sub tree that is 24 less than 67. Now in the sequence it cannot be 74 because this number is greater that the root 67. The number in the sequence can be greater than 24 but strictly less than 67..
